Royal Enfield Thunderbird 650 Specifications

Engine 650 CC Liquid-Cooled
Layout Parallel Twin
Maximum Power 47 PS at 7,000 RPM
Peak Torque 52 Nm at 4,000 RPM
Transmission 6-Speed, Manual Transmission

The new Royal Enfield Thunderbird 650 will gets its engine from the Interceptor. The new Royal Enfield comes with a new 650cc parallel-twin engine that looks a lot like another RE parallel twin of the yore. However, the new motor is a thoroughly modern unit and offers a peak power of 47 PS at 7,000 RPM along with a maximum torque of 52 Nm at 4,000 RPM. The engine will be mated to a 6-speed manual transmission and has a SOHC head. The oil-cooler for the engine features a small radiator that is mounted on the double-cradle chassis.

Royal Enfield Thunderbird 650 – Features

The cruiser is likely to get the features which are not much different from the other Thunderbird siblings in the market. It might get the Dual-Channel ABS with front and rear disc brakes. Other features will include an Engine Kill Switch, LED Always On projector headlamps, full instrument panel with digital trip meter and low fuel oil and side stand sensors.
